When comparing trading costs for Nicaragua traders, FBS offers competitive spreads starting from 0.7 pips on its Standard account with no commission, which suits small-volume traders. VT Markets, on the other hand, provides spreads from 0.0 pips on its Raw ECN account but charges a commission of $3 per lot per side. For a Nicaragua trader executing 10 lots per month, VT Markets can be cheaper due to lower spreads, while FBS is more cost-effective for traders with lower volume. Both brokers have no hidden fees for deposits via Bank Transfer, Skrill, Neteller, or USDT TRC20.

Both FBS and VT Markets offer MetaTrader 4 and MetaTrader 5, which are widely used by Nicaragua traders. FBS also provides its own FBS Trader app for mobile users, which is lightweight and works well on slower connections. VT Markets offers additional platforms like cTrader for ECN trading, which is popular among scalpers. For Nicaragua traders, the choice depends on preference: FBS is simpler and more beginner-friendly, while VT Markets offers more advanced tools for experienced traders.

FBS is regulated by the International Financial Services Commission (IFSC) in Belize and the Financial Sector Conduct Authority (FSCA) in South Africa. VT Markets is regulated by the Financial Services Authority (FSA) in St. Vincent and the Grenadines and the Australian Securities and Investments Commission (ASIC). Neither broker is directly supervised by the local financial regulator in Nicaragua, but their international licenses provide a level of oversight. For Nicaragua traders, this means deposits are protected by the broker's policies, but not by a local compensation scheme. Always check the latest regulatory status before trading.

Nicaragua traders can fund their accounts at both FBS and VT Markets using Bank Transfer, Skrill, Neteller, and USDT TRC20. FBS has a minimum deposit of $5 via e-wallets and $10 via bank transfer, while VT Markets requires a minimum of $50 for most methods. Withdrawals are processed within 24 hours for e-wallets and 1-3 business days for bank transfers at both brokers. USDT TRC20 deposits are particularly fast, with confirmation in minutes and no additional fees. FBS offers more flexible deposit options with lower minimums, making it more accessible for retail traders in Nicaragua.

Both FBS and VT Markets provide Islamic (swap-free) accounts for Muslim traders in Nicaragua. FBS offers Islamic accounts on all account types, including Standard and ECN, upon request. VT Markets provides swap-free accounts on Standard and Raw ECN accounts, but may charge an administration fee if the account is inactive for a certain period. For Nicaragua traders, both options comply with Sharia law, but FBS has simpler terms with no inactivity fees. Traders should confirm eligibility and any conditions before opening an Islamic account.
